Handover Note — Director transition, Commercial Finance

To the finance team: as I hand responsibilities to Director Maren Holt, please note our exposure to Veltrix Industrial, which now represents 41% of Quentara Systems' annual revenue. Payment terms remain favourable, but any contraction at Veltrix would materially affect our cash forecasts. Maren will lead the diversification workstream from next month. Please review the attached ledger breakdown before Thursday's session. The confidential outline of our mitigation plan follows below.

board note of fahif-yahog: Gross margin on Wenath came in at 10 percent against a plan of 5 percent. Only 3 of the 100 pilot accounts renewed Wenath, so a churn review is set for July 15.

**Action item: dependency pinning policy (Quillbase outage follow-up)**

All services must pin direct dependencies to exact versions. Lockfiles are mandatory and reviewed in CI. Transitive drift gets flagged weekly by the Fencepost bot. New hires: do not use floating ranges, ever. The enforcement thresholds the bot applies are shown below.

tuning constants:
QUOTAS = {
    "druwyn": 5,
    "holix": 5,
    "zorath": 5,
    "holwyn": 10,
}

## Deployment

Nightjar, our scheduler for nightly data backfills, deploys from the main branch via the standard pipeline. Each release restarts the coordinator, which re-reads the job catalog and resumes any interrupted backfills from their last checkpoint. If you're on call, deploy only outside the 01:00–05:00 backfill window; mid-run restarts are safe but slow recovery. After deployment, confirm the coordinator logs a clean catalog load and check the lag dashboard. The coordinator starts with the configuration values below.

deployment values, kajep-kageg:
[praix]
host = praix.paliqcorp.corp
user = praix_svc
database = praix_prod